Not Mounting Your Dishwasher Appropriately Can Cause a Mountain of Issues
Not just can installing a dishwashing machine properly nullify your service warranty, but it can likewise produce a mess. If you do not set up the supply line correctly, you can deal with leaks-- or even worse, a flooding. You might likewise experience a "water hammer"-- when the water runs also rapidly with your pipes and also causes loud drinking audios. If you improperly install your dish washer to the rubbish disposal, you may observe pungent scents or have residue on your recipes.

Setting Up a Dish Washer Requires a Selection of Tools
If you do not have a selection of tools handy, you may require to make a trip to copyright's or House Depot. To mount a dishwasher, you need the complying with tools: pliers, an adjustable wrench, a set of screwdrivers, a tube cutter, and hole saws. You will likewise require cleansing products such as a shallow pail and sponge. If you do not have any one of these things, the cost to purchase them can build up quickly.
A Plumber Can Inspect the Supply Lines
A supply line, especially a dishwashing machine connector, attaches the dishwashing machine to a water source. A plumber can ensure that the line is compatible with both your dish washer as well as water resource if you buy a new supply line. If you determine to use an existing supply line, a specialist plumber can inspect it to guarantee that it remains in good condition as well as does not have any leaks.

PLUMBING SERVICES YOU'LL NEED FOR A KITCHEN REMODEL
SINK AND DISHWASHER INSTALLATION
If you want to relocate the sink and dishwasher, major plumbing work needs to be done. The sink needs an access point to both hot and cold water, which connects from the faucets and a waste-pipe. Your dishwasher calls for the same type of plumbing work. The water supply and waste-pipe access are extended from the sink to the dishwasher, which is why these two appliances need to be placed next to each other.
If you're simply looking to have a new sink installed in the same location, less professional work needs to be done, meaning your bill will be significantly cheaper. When shopping for a new sink, consider upgrading to features like extensions, sprayers, soap dispensers and a stainless steel garbage disposal.
